This page provides the latest information on University of Detroit Mercy (UDM)'s admission process, acceptance rate, and student profile. UDM's acceptance rate is 75.42% for 2024-2025 admission. A total of 6,514 students applied and 4,913 were admitted to the school. Its acceptance rate is relatively high, making it somewhat easy to get into UDM.
To apply to UDM, personal statement (or essay) is required to submit and recommendations is not required but considered. The SAT and ACT score is not required, but considered for admission. In addition, english proficiency test score is also considered (required).
For the academic year 2024-25, UDM's acceptance rate is 75.42% and the yield (also known as enrollment rate) is 13.23%. 2,527 men and 3,950 women applied to UDM and 1,715 men and 3,189 women students were accepted.
10 applicants who has another gender applied and 8 were accepted.1 accepted students' gender is unknown.
Among them, 225 men and 424 women were enrolled in UDM. You can explore the UDM's admission rates and SAT score trends over the past decade, including year-by-year data and analysis, by visiting Admission Trends page.
| Total | Men | Women | Another Gender | Gender Unknown |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Applicants | 6,514 | 2,527 | 3,950 | 10 | 27 |
| Admitted | 4,913 | 1,715 | 3,189 | 8 | 1 |
| Enrolled | 650 | 225 | 424 | 0 | 1 |
| Acceptance Rate | 75.42% | 67.87% | 80.73% | 80.00% | 3.70% |
| Yield | 13.23% | 13.12% | 13.30% | 0.00% | 100.00% |
Data source: IPEDS (Integrated Postsecondary Education Data System) (Last update: December 11, 2024)
For the academic year 2025, 329 students (51% of enrolled students) submitted SAT scores and 39 students (6% of enrolled students) submitted ACT scores as part of the admission process at UDM.
The median SAT score for admitted students is 1,120, including 560 in SAT Evidence-Based Reading and Writing (EBRW) and 560 in SAT Math. The 75th percentile SAT EBRW score is 630 and the 25th percentile is 520. For SAT Math, the 75th percentile score is 630 and the 25th percentile is 510.
The median ACT composite score is 26, with a 75th percentile score of 28 and a 25th percentile score of 22 at UDM. The median ACT Math score is 26 and the median ACT English score is 24.
The SAT and ACT scores at University of Detroit Mercy are similar to the average score compared to similar colleges (SAT: 1,177, ACT: 25 - private (not-for-profit) doctoral / research university).
| 25th Percentile | 50th Percentile (Median) | 75th Percentile | |
|---|---|---|---|
| SAT Total | 1,030 | 1,120 | 1,260 |
| SAT Evidence-Based Reading and Writing | 520 | 560 | 630 |
| SAT Math | 510 | 560 | 630 |
| ACT Composite | 22 | 26 | 28 |
| ACT Math | 22 | 26 | 28 |
| ACT English | 21 | 24 | 28 |
Data source: IPEDS (Integrated Postsecondary Education Data System) (Last update: December 11, 2024)
For the academic year 2024-25, total 650 first-year students enrolled in UDM. The proportion of full-time students is 97.08% and part-time students is 2.92%.
By gender, the proportion of men students is 34.62% and women students is 65.23%.
The following table shows the first-year students by gender and enrolled type at UDM.
| Total | Men | Women | Another Gender | Gender Unknown |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Total | 650 | 225 | 424 | 0 | 1 |
| Full-time | 631 | 217 | 413 | 0 | 1 |
| Part-time | 19 | 8 | 11 | 0 | 0 |
Data source: IPEDS (Integrated Postsecondary Education Data System) (Last update: December 11, 2024)
It requires to submit High School GPA, High School Record (or Transcript), Completion of College Preparatory Program, English Proficiency Test, and Personal statement or essay to its applicants.
The SAT and ACT test score is not required, but considered in admission process at UDM. The english proficiency test is required .
The next table summarizes the application requirements to apply University of Detroit Mercy.
For more admission information such as minimum GPA and deadlines, see its online application page .
| High School GPA | Required |
|---|---|
| High School Rank | Considered, if submitted |
| High School Record (or Transcript) | Required |
| Completion of College Preparatory Program | Required |
| Recommendations | Considered, if submitted |
| Formal Demonstration of Competencies | Considered, if submitted |
| SAT / ACT | Considered, if submitted |
| English Proficiency Test | Required |
| Other Test (Wonderlic,WISC-III,etc) | Considered, if submitted |
| Work experience | Considered, if submitted |
| Personal statement or essay | Required |
| Legacy status | Considered, if submitted |
